The idea of searching for coins is the most tangible for most people. While there are relic hunters out there that are looking for items in the past, most are looking for something that has a more apparent value. This means that popping coins out of the ground is more appealing.

This can be done in many ways and as such you have to be sure that you are ready for the deal. That is the process at hand when you are looking to the idea of probing for coins in light of digging.

The idea of probing is one that is very nice for the people that are out there looking to score some nicer coins. This is also a time saving effort on the part of the hunter. It takes a lot less time to probe a coin out then it does to dig a plug.

So you can see that over time the idea of using the probe is going to be more appealing. But you have to learn the proper technique for coin probing. If not then you might end up damaging a very valuable coin in the process.

Equipment
You need to get yourself a good coin probe. Now this can be purchased at many places, including online. But you can see that many are going to tell you that a regular old screwdriver will work. Well that is not the truth. In light you have to have something that has a blunt end.

If not then you could be scratching the surface of the coins. In many cases you will find that you are going to get a brass probe which is good because it is far less likely to cause any damage.

Starting Out
The first thing that you need to do is learn how to tell that you have hit the coin. This is something that is highly important for the people of the world. When you are dealing with soil that is full of rocks then you know that you are getting the wrong impression.

It is important for you to make sure that you are practicing all the time to tell the difference between the rocks and other hard objects and the coin itself. This will be vital to your success out there coin probing.

Deeper Coins
There is the chance that you might not be able to probe the coin out. If the coin is deeper then the probe will go then you are going to have to be sure that you are cutting a plug. Still, you should keep the probe handy. It will be nice to use when you are looking in the hole for the coin.
